v2.1.0.9805 Patch Notes

Keep Digging v2.1.0.9805 has been released.

In this update, we have made major revisions to graphics-related settings and resources so that the game can launch and run more stably across a wider range of PC environments.

To improve launch issues that occurred on some systems, we have reviewed the use of rendering features that can place a heavy load on hardware and readjusted the in-game graphics resources.

If you continue to experience issues, we would appreciate it if you could report them with details about the situation in which they occurred.

Optimization & Performance

  • Discontinued the use of rendering features such as Nanite, Lumen, and MegaLight to improve performance.

  • Reviewed, optimized, and readjusted the overall graphics resources.

  • Reduced performance drops when moving quickly or digging at high speed.

  • Added DirectX 11 compatibility mode. Please try this option if the game does not launch.

  • Adjusted some maps from Keep Digging Version 1.0 and reduced high-load elements such as grass.

Balance Adjustments

  • Added fast travel points.

  • Batteries now recharge near fast travel points.

Bug Fixes

  • Conducted testing across various hardware environments and fixed an issue where the game would not launch on some systems.

  • Fixed an issue in multiplayer where terrain synchronization could sometimes fail.

Other

  • Enhanced the crash reporter so that comments can now be submitted when a crash occurs. If you experience a crash and know the situation or reproduction steps, it would be very helpful if you could include them in the comment field.
